Information about Sober Living in Sandy Utah

Sober living in Sandy, Utah is a rising trend nowadays, especially for those individuals who have recently recovered from drug and alcohol addiction. It is a place for them to stay while they transition back to their normal lives and routines. Sober living homes provide a supportive, nurturing, and structured environment that aims to help addicts rebuild their lives by instilling discipline, responsibility, and self-accountability. It is an ideal place to begin the process of recovery and healing.Sober living homes can be found in different locations within Sandy, Utah. They are strategically built in quiet neighborhoods and near public transportation systems. The homes themselves are designed to accommodate different needs, from gender-specific homes to homes which cater for the LGBTQ community, to the elderly.The staff at the sober living homes are experienced and skilled in handling various addiction cases. They are trained to provide assistance on an individualized level, and residents have access to one-on-one counseling and group sessions as well. This support network is essential in helping recovering addicts become accountable, gain self-confidence, and explore solutions to their current and potential issues.The sober living homes in Sandy, Utah also employ a system of rules and regulations, which help maintain order and structure within the facility. Usually, a curfew is implemented to prevent the residents from staying out late, and regular drug screening is conducted to ensure compliance with the rules. Additionally, residents are required to engage in daily tasks as part of fulfilling their responsibilities around the home.For the residents, the daily routine of sober living consists of various activities which enhance self-accountability and discipline. It begins with daily chore assignments, such as cleaning, cooking, and shopping. This practice fosters a sense of responsibility, teamwork, and self-reliance. Physical fitness and exercise are also encouraged as part of the daily routine, and residents are provided with opportunities to engage in outdoor recreational activities, alongside their peers.While sober living homes do have regulations and a set of standards, there is no backslapping or punitive measures imposed on residents. The staff understands that relapse is part of the recovery process, and they work to help residents understand the triggers and possible pressure points that can lead to a relapse. Staff also work with recovered addicts to provide tools and strategies to help them manage cravings and avoid temptation.One aspect of sober living in Sandy, Utah, which sets it apart from other states, is the sense of community fostered amongst residents. Recovering addicts live in a close-knit environment where they receive support from their peers. Participation in group therapy can establish the sense of camaraderie that can lead to developing long-lasting and profound friendships.Living in a sober living home is not always easy, and some of the challenges residents may face can include combating boredom or re-establishing relationships with family and friends outside of the home. However, with the right support network and a bit of patience, these individuals are eventually able to make a successful transition back into society and continue to maintain their sobriety.In conclusion, sober living in Sandy, Utah, offers a safe, and structured environment that promotes personal growth and recovery of individuals affected by substance abuse. The homes have experienced staff, who provide necessary support as the residents work through their addictions. The camaraderie and sense of community that develops amongst the residents are incredibly beneficial, as it provides a supportive and encouragement atmosphere during the recovery process. Graduates of the program often report going on to live fulfilling lives free of drugs and alcohol. It is essential to mention that, although it is not always an easy journey, the path to recovery through sober living creates a road to successful and sustainable long-term sobriety.
